Welcome to Greece! On your first day, you'll arrive in Athens, the vibrant capital city. After settling into your hotel, start your exploration by visiting the iconic Acropolis. Marvel at the ancient ruins, including the Parthenon, and enjoy panoramic views of the city. Take a leisurely stroll through the charming Plaka neighborhood, known for its narrow streets, traditional tavernas, and souvenir shops. Indulge in some delicious Greek cuisine for dinner, trying local specialties like moussaka, souvlaki, or fresh seafood.
Today, you'll embark on an island-hopping adventure! Catch a ferry from Athens to Hydra, a picturesque island known for its tranquil atmosphere and absence of cars. Explore the charming harbor town, wander through the narrow streets lined with stone houses, and relax on the beautiful beaches. Enjoy a leisurely lunch at a waterfront taverna, savoring fresh seafood and Greek mezes.
In the afternoon, hop on a ferry to Aegina, another lovely island known for its sandy beaches and historical sites. Visit the Temple of Aphaia, an ancient Greek temple with stunning views of the island. Take a dip in the crystal-clear waters of Agia Marina beach or explore the colorful fishing village of Perdika. End the day with a sunset cocktail overlooking the Aegean Sea.
On your final day of island hopping, catch a ferry to Poros, a small and charming island known for its lush greenery and beautiful beaches. Take a leisurely walk along the waterfront promenade, lined with cafes and restaurants. Visit the historic Clock Tower, offering panoramic views of the island and the surrounding sea. Spend some time relaxing on the sandy beaches or take a boat tour around the island to discover hidden coves and secluded spots.
In the afternoon, return to Athens and explore the vibrant city further. Visit the National Archaeological Museum, home to an impressive collection of ancient Greek artifacts. Take a stroll through the trendy neighborhood of Psiri, known for its street art, boutique shops, and lively nightlife. Enjoy a farewell dinner at a rooftop restaurant, indulging in delicious Greek cuisine while enjoying breathtaking views of the illuminated Acropolis.
Throughout your trip, make sure to sample the local delicacies, such as feta cheese, olives, tzatziki, and baklava. Don't forget to try the famous Greek coffee and sip on some refreshing ouzo or local wines.
Remember, Greece is best enjoyed at a relaxed pace, so take your time to soak in the beauty of the islands, indulge in the delicious food, and embrace the laid-back Mediterranean lifestyle.
